Talk of a citywide youth curfew has sparked debate in Montgomery communities.
. Many people expressed their opinions at Destiny Driven Inc.’s community debate Wednesday night.
“A curfew, when thoughtfully designed and effectively enforced, can serve as a powerful tool,” said LAMP High School junior Aaron Fullard.
